The Test of Phased Array Antenna for Marine Seismic Data Transmission

2021 
Abstract This paper mainly analyzes the test results of a phased array antenna for real-time sea-area seismic datatransmission. The real-time data backhaul effects to the onshore data processing center through the phased array antenna in the sea-area seismic detection process was tested in the specified sea area. The test results show that the phased array antenna can transmit stably the detection data across the sea for 105km. The transmission delay is within 2 to 3 seconds, and the transmission rate reaches 40Kbps while the transmission loss rate is only about 1.5%. 99.5% of the detection data is well received and the power consumption of the whole system is 30W. It can be seen from the test results that the phased array antenna system can satisfactorily meet the real-time seismic databackhaul requirements in the transoceanic seas, and thus can provide technical support for the development of seismic detection
